Hydraulic jumps are normally associated with waterflowing in rivers, gullies, and other such relatively high-speed open channels. However, recently, hydraulic jumps have been used invarious manufacturing processes involving fluids other than water(such as liquid metal solder) in relatively small-scale flows. Obtaininformation about new manufacturing processes that involvehydraulic jumps as an integral part of the process. Summarize yourfindings in a brief report.
